刚入门的python的同学可能尚未接触过python函数的编写,其实python添加函数入口可以保证模块执行的独立性又不影响模块被其他模块引用(import)。函数的编写:def main(): pass if __name__ == '__main__': main()__name_属于python中的一个内置属性,通常来说一个py文件可以直接执行和被其他模块导入,程序第
转载 2023-05-22 14:06:19
247阅读
文章目录前言一、数据类型与运算符二、函数专题(参数接口+内置+嵌套+递归+匿名)特别专题:参数引用特别专题:Lambda的应用特别专题:深拷贝与浅拷贝(面试高频)三、容器专题(集合+元组+字典+列表+字符串+序列操作)sort()与sorted()使用zip建一个微小型数据库的实例:enumerate举例:Python移除元素方法的合集四、类和对象专题(定义+实例化调用+关键字+魔法方法)基础概
引子现在老板让你一个监控程序,24小时全年无休的监控你们公司网站服务器的系统状况,当cpu\memory\disk等指标的使用量超过阀值时即发邮件报警,你掏空了所有的知识量,写出了以下代码while True: if cpu利用率 > 90%: #发送邮件提醒 连接邮箱服务器 发送邮件 关闭连接 if 硬盘使
前言:正文:本文档基于Raymond Hettinger 2013年在Pycon US的演讲. 文档中的代码是基于Python2, 对于Python3改动的地方做了注释.YouTube传送门:videoPPT传送门:slides使用xrange(py2)/ range(py3)for i in [0, 1, 2, 3, 4, 5]: print i**2 for i in range(6): pr
Python函数写法Python是一种高级编程语言,已成为许多业界和科学应用程序的首选语言。在Python中,函数(也称为程序入口)是代码的起点。本文将简要介绍Python函数的写法,并提供一些有用的技巧和建议。什么是函数函数Python程序的入口点,它是程序执行的第一个位置。在Python中,函数是指编写在脚本的顶部,通常伴随着导入语句和全局变量声明的代码段。下面是一个Python
# 项目方案:学生信息管理系统 ## 1. 项目介绍 本项目是一个学生信息管理系统,用于管理学校的学生信息。通过该系统,学校可以方便地添加、编辑、删除学生信息,并能够查询学生的基本信息、成绩等。 ## 2. 功能需求 本项目的主要功能需求如下: - 添加学生信息:输入学生的基本信息,包括学号、姓名、性别、年龄等。 - 编辑学生信息:根据学号查询学生信息,并可以修改学生的基本信息。 - 删除
原创 2023-09-14 17:07:58
71阅读
如何编写Java中的函数 在Java中,函数是程序的入口点,它定义了程序的执行起点。函数的正确编写对于程序的运行是非常重要的。本文将介绍如何正确编写Java中的函数,并通过一个具体的问题来演示。 ## 函数的基本结构 函数通常有以下基本结构: ```java public class Main { public static void main(String[] arg
原创 2024-01-14 03:56:53
67阅读
IDE 函数 引用 子函数在安装Anaconda后,便自动有了Spyder,该IDE和Matlab非常相似,在运行代码后查看数据内容和类型、图表等非常友好。函数 如何调用 子函数 呢?有两种方法: 函数中可以三种形式:(Subfunction是子函数文件名,一个文件下可以放很多子函数哦,比如其中有一个函数是):import Subfunctionimport Subfunction as
转载 2023-06-07 14:32:03
671阅读
函数特殊之处格式是固定的被jvm识别和调用public class MainDemo{ public static void main(String[] args){ } }函数关键字解释public:因为权限必须是最大的。 static:不需要对象,直接用函数所属类名调用即可。 void:函数没有具体的返回值。 main(函数名):不是关键字,只是一个jvm识别的固定的
进行编程肯定要会用函数,所以要知道各种函数的用处。常用内置函数:(不用import就可以直接使用) :help(obj) 在线帮助, obj可是任何类型callable(obj) 查看一个obj是不是可以像函数一样调用repr(obj) 得到obj的表示字符串,可以利用这个字符串eval重建该对象的一个拷贝eval_r(str) 表示合法的python表达式,返回这个表达式dir(obj) 查看o
数学中的函数一词泛指发生在集合之间的一种对应关系和变化过程。在程序设计领域,函数实际上就是一段具有特定功能、完成特定任务的程序,以减少重复编写程序段的工作量。在面向过程程序设计中也被称为过程(Procedure)、子程序(Sub-program),在面向对象程序设计中则被称为方法(Method)。本教程之前使用的 print( ) 函数就是常用的函数之一。在 Python 中定义一个函数需要遵循以
下面对java中的函数进行简单的解释,解决可能困惑大家的问题,下面举的例子在实际开发中几乎不会出现,但是为了解决好奇心,大家可以这么去尝试一下!我们在java中看到的函数通常是这样的:public static void main(String[] args) public:访问权限最高。static:静态,表示加载类的时候函数就已经存在了。void:表示函数不返回任何值。mai
转载 2023-05-26 11:14:47
170阅读
 JAVA中的函数是我们再熟悉不过的了,相信每个学习过JAVA语言的人都能够熟练地写出这个程序的入口函数,但对于函数为什么这么,其中的每个关键字分别是什么意思,可能就不是所有人都能轻松地答出来的了。我也是在学习中碰到了这个问题,通过在网上搜索资料,并加上自己的实践终于有了一点心得,不敢保留,写出来与大家分享。 函数的一般写法如下: public static void main(
转载 2023-05-23 13:00:34
69阅读
初次接触Python的人会很不习惯Python没有main函数。 这里简单的介绍一下,在Python中使用main函数的方法 #hello.py def foo(): str="function" print(str); if __name__=="__main__": print("main") foo() 其中i
转载 2023-06-05 22:29:15
263阅读
能够调用自己编写的函数,这在很多开发语言中,都会用到一个叫做mian的函数,这个函数一般都是程序的入口,当程序启动时,首先执行这个函数。在Python中,main函数的主要作用就是你的模块既可以导入到别的模块中用,也可以在模块本身执行使用。下面就来了解具体使用操作吧。编写简单的函数并调用:def show():print("这是一个简单的函数")print("无论如何,我都会输出")print
转载 2023-05-23 17:04:55
166阅读
# 将Python函数函数分开并调用的方案 在Python编程中,将函数与主程序分开编写是一种良好的编程习惯,这样不仅可以提升代码的可读性,还能提高重用性和可维护性。本文将介绍如何将函数与主程序分开,并通过一个具体问题来说明如何实现。我们将创建一个旅行计划管理程序,用户可以输入多个目的地,并输出总行程。 ## 代码示例 首先,我们定义一个函数来处理旅行计划。该函数将接受用户输入的目的地
原创 2024-08-04 04:56:46
228阅读
# Python函数文件在函数中的使用 在Python中,我们常常需要将代码模块化,以便于管理和重用。模块化的一个常见做法是将一组相关的函数写入一个单独的文件中,然后在函数中调用这些函数。本文将详细介绍如何在Python中实现这一过程,并展示如何使用Markdown语法来标识代码示例,以及如何使用Mermaid语法来创建饼状图和序列图。 ## 函数文件的创建 首先,我们需要创建一个包含自
原创 2024-07-27 10:51:06
33阅读
知识点:1.函数基本语法及特性2.参数与局部变量3.返回值 嵌套函数4.递归5.匿名函数6.函数式编程7.高阶函数8.内置函数字符编码python2py2里默认编码是ascii 文件开头那个编码声明是告诉解释这个代码的程序 以什么编码格式 把这段代码读入到内存,因为到了内存里,这段代码其实是以bytes二进制格式存的,不过即使是2进制流,也可以按不同的编码格式转成2进制流 如果在文件头声明了#_
顺序栈的函数怎么Java 在Java编程中,栈是一种常见的数据结构,它遵循后进先出(LIFO)的原则。顺序栈作为栈的一种实现方式,使用数组来存储数据。本文旨在通过对“顺序栈的函数怎么Java”的分析,提供解决这个问题的详细过程,并展示如何顺利实现一个顺序栈的函数。 ### 问题背景 在软件开发中,栈的应用广泛且重要,为了满足不同的业务需求,我们经常需要实现和使用顺序栈的结构。若顺序
原创 7月前
15阅读
# 如何找到函数Python中,我们通常使用`if __name__ == "__main__":`来定义函数,这是因为Python中的每个文件都可以被当作一个模块来导入,并且每个模块都有一个特殊的属性`__name__`。当直接运行一个Python文件时,`__name__`的值会被自动设置为`__main__`,而当文件作为模块被导入时,`__name__`的值会被设置为模块的名称。
原创 2023-07-22 12:57:02
210阅读
  • 1
  • 2
  • 3
  • 4
  • 5